Writing as a Waking Dream: Stimulating creativity and turning ideas into text.
Saturday, November 6, 2004, 10 AM - 3 PM (one hr lunch on your own)
Writing and dreams have their origin in the gold of the unconscious - weird
and troubling, mysterious and wise, layered with meaning in metaphor and
symbol. The messages are transcendent, inspirational, and timeless. We'll use
experiential techniques and prompts to capture the insights from our unconscious
that lead to creative and original writing. Topics include getting in flow,
passionate writing, plunging and planning, using dreams, fantasies, and the
repeating themes of our lives.

The Nature of Rage
Rage can be debilitating, dangerous, or the wellspring of change and
growth. What we do with rage - ours and others' - can determine our
continued suffering or our turning the energy of anger into productive
action. Self-awareness about our anger can prevent us from acting out
our anger instead of managing it productively and appropriately. An
awareness of the warning signs of rage in others and knowledge of how
to diffuse it can prevent violence in the home and in the workplace.
This six-hour seminar will look at sources of rage, and handling your
own rage as well as that of others.
